Identifying The Nearest Disaster Shelters
When a crisis strikes, knowing where to find a secure disaster shelter can be essential for a family’s safety. Don’t wait until an event is already happening; take the moment now to get to know regional resources. Many towns have selected shelters, including schools and public buildings to specialized buildings. To promptly identify a nearest refuge, consult local authorities' online databases. You can also contact local emergency management agencies by phone or through online channels. Remember to gather essential items with necessities like provisions and medical assistance for a stay.
Finding Ideal Survival Shelter Spots & Available Resources
When erecting a survival shelter, the choice of location is absolutely critical. Consider pre-made formations – a dense thicket of trees, a rock overhang, or even a shallow cave can offer significant protection from the weather. Prioritize elevated ground to prevent flooding, and be mindful of potential hazards like falling rocks or wildlife. Convenient access to clean water is another key factor; ideally, your shelter should be within a manageable distance of a river. Gathering materials for your shelter is also crucial; look for fallen branches, foliage for insulation, and strong vines or pliable roots for binding sections together. Remember to assess the overall environment – is there ample fuel for a fire, and is the area relatively concealed from view? Finally, always be aware of potential dangers and adapt your approach accordingly.
